Bright White Light is an intriguing exploration of near-death experiences, crafted through a blend of animation and real audio recordings. Each of the five narratives showcases a different cultural perspective, making it a rich tapestry of human experience. The visuals are experimental, almost surreal at times, which really drives home the transcendent theme. The pacing is contemplative, giving you space to dwell on the profound implications of life and death. It’s not your typical documentary; it's more like a visual meditation that pulls you into the depths of the unknown. The distinctiveness lies in its ability to blend real voices with animation, creating a unique emotional resonance that lingers long after the film ends.
